两条直线之间的距离怎么求?

www.zhiqu.org     时间: 2024-06-02
两条平面直线之间的距离是指这两条直线上任意一点与另一条直线的最短距离。计算两条直线之间的距离是很常见的数学问题,尤其在几何和物理学中经常会用到。
假设有两条平面直线,分别为L1和L2,我们需要求出它们之间的距离。首先,我们需要选择一个点P1在L1上,和一个点P2在L2上,这两个点之间的距离就是L1和L2之间的距离。因为任意一条直线上的点到另一条直线的距离都是最短的,所以P1P2的距离就是我们要求的距离。
接下来的问题是如何确定P1和P2的位置。我们可以通过垂线的概念来解决这个问题。垂线是指与一条直线相交且与该直线垂直的直线。我们可以通过从P1和P2分别作垂线,使它们分别与L2和L1相交,然后再连接这两个垂足,得到P1P2的长度。
具体来说,我们可以将L1表示为ax + by + c1 = 0的形式,其中a、b和c1是实数常数。同样地,我们可以将L2表示为dx + ey + c2 = 0的形式。为了方便计算,我们可以将L1和L2分别表示为点斜式的形式,即y = mx + b1和y = nx + b2,其中m和n分别是L1和L2的斜率,b1和b2是它们的截距。
现在,我们可以选择L1上的任意一点(x1, y1),它与L2之间的距离为:
d = |ax1 + by1 + c1| / sqrt(a^2 + b^2)
为了求解P1和P2的位置,我们需要找到垂线的方程。我们以L1为例,假设从(x1, y1)到L2的垂线的垂足为(x2, y2),则垂线的斜率为:
m' = -1/m
垂足的坐标可以通过解下面的方程组求得:
y1 = m'(x2 - x1) + y2
n(x2 - x1) + y2 = b2
解出x2和y2即可得到垂足的坐标。同样地,我们也可以找到从L2到L1的垂线的垂足的坐标。
最后,我们可以计算出P1和P2之间的距离:
d(P1, P2) = sqrt((x2 - x1)^2 + (y2 - y1)^2)
综上所述,计算两条直线之间的距离需要选择垂足,然后计算出垂足之间的距离即可。这个问题虽然比较复杂,但是在数学和物理等领域中经常会用到,因此掌握这个问题的求解方法对于学习和应用都非常有帮助。

~


#胥饼庭# 怎样求两条直线之间的距离,不一定是平行关系 -
(19752179873): 只有两条平行直线之间才有一个固定的距离.不平行时他们之间的距离可以从零到无穷大.

#胥饼庭# 两直线间距离公式平行直线给两个直线方程,求距离 - 作业帮
(19752179873):[答案] 两平行线分别为L1:Ax+By+C1=0,L2:Ax+By+C2=0在L2上任取一点P(x0,y0)则Ax0+By0+C2=0,Ax0+By0=-C2根据点到直线距离公式:P到L1距离为:|Ax0+By0+C1|/√(A²+B²)=|-C2+C1|/√(A²+B²)=|C1-C2|...

#胥饼庭# 两条平行直线之间的距离怎么算? - 作业帮
(19752179873):[答案] 作平行线的垂直线,垂直线与两条平行线交点的直线距离.就是所求的距离

#胥饼庭# 两平行直线距离求法 - 作业帮
(19752179873):[答案] 设两条直线 Ax+By+C1=0 Ax+By+C2=0 设点P(a,b)在直线Ax+By+C1=0上,P到直线Ax+By+C2=0距离为 d=|Aa+Bb+C2|/√(A^2+B^2)=|-C1+C2|/√(A^2+B^2) =|C1-C2|/√(A^2+B^2)

#胥饼庭# 两条直线的距离怎么求?平行的不对 有两个A两个B 到底是哪个带进公式? - 作业帮
(19752179873):[答案] 两平行直线Ax+By+C1=0,Ax+By+C2=0,那么他们间的距离为 d = |C1-C2| /根号下(A^2+B^2)

#胥饼庭# 两直线间距离公式 -
(19752179873): 两平行线分别为L1:Ax+By+C1=0,L2:Ax+By+C2=0 在L2上任取一点P(x0,y0) 则Ax0+By0+C2=0,Ax0+By0=-C2 根据点到直线距离公式: P到L1距离为: |Ax0+By0+C1|/√(A²+B²) =|-C2+C1|/√(A²+B²) =|C1-C2|/√(A²+B²)

#胥饼庭# 两直线的距离公式
(19752179873): 建立空间3维坐标`用向量表示出两条直线 再求出他们的公垂线的方向向量`最后在求就行了

#胥饼庭# 求两条平行直线之间距离公式 -
(19752179873): l1:ax+by+c1=0 l2:ax+by+c2=0 距离是:(c1-c2)的绝对值除以根号下(a平方加b平方)

#胥饼庭# 如何获得两条平行直线之间的距离? -
(19752179873): 求两条直线之间的距离,转化为一条直线L1上取一点A(可为起点),直线L2上取两点C(L2起点)、D(终点),两条直线L1、L2重合时可利用AC、AD的叉乘为0即可(AC x AD=0),不重合共线时,求两条直线之间的距离方法就比较多了,方法1:可先求出三角形的面积SACD,可利用叉乘计算,再利用三角形底CD的长度计算方法2:利用方法GetClosestPointTo求出A在CD上的垂足,再求出距离...当然还有很多方法,以上只是我的看法

#胥饼庭# 两条平行直线之间的距离怎么算? -
(19752179873): 随便在任意一条线上选择一个点,以这个点作另一条线的垂直线,这条垂直线的长度就是两条平行直线之间的距离